Output 74e591e662aed2ead3e32bdd78fffcc7a153839eea2551d0ab53edb9d546d48e:1

value
9505100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eed13920c907b61189618edabaa575cc8886179 OP_EQUAL
address
MPr5pAkq7MCUmEmJ56QCdKTRR1Zvvf24XF
transaction
74e591e662aed2ead3e32bdd78fffcc7a153839eea2551d0ab53edb9d546d48e
spent
true